Minutes — Management Meeting, Carraway Group

Present: T. Obel (chair), R. Vance, M. Ketteridge. The revised sales-commission scheme was reviewed and approved for rollout across all Fenwick-region branches. Base rates remain unchanged; accelerators apply beyond quota, and team-based pools replace individual overrides for the Brindle product line. Payroll confirmed systems readiness. R. Vance will circulate final tables to branch managers by month-end. The board should note one confidential item recorded immediately below these minutes.

confidential, kagep-kahof: Druokax Systems plans to lower the Ulaath list price by 53 percent in March.

Subject: Handover — validator plugin stuff

Hey Priya,

Passing you the baton on Checkwright, our plugin system for data validators. The new schema-drift plugin shipped Tuesday and mostly behaves, but it occasionally flags empty CSV uploads as "malformed" — harmless, just noisy. I've muted the alert until Friday. If support escalates anything about plugin load failures, the fix is usually bumping the registry cache. Questions after I'm off? Reach the Checkwright maintainers at the address below.

billing contact of hawip-kahif = zorwyn@tolvaqlabs.corp

**Ticket: Config drift on BounceSift processor**

The email bounce processor in the Larkfield environment has drifted from the values committed in the release branch. Retry windows and suppression thresholds no longer match, which likely explains the duplicate suppression entries reported Tuesday. Please reconcile before the Thursday cut. For reference, the currently deployed configuration on the live node reads as follows.

config for yajep-yahof:
[briax]
port = 9200
region = outer-2
host = briax.nelvrocorp.test
team = raleth
timeout_ms = 1500
retries = 1

## Linkbridge 2.4 — New Defaults

Quick note for support: deep links now fall back to the web view instead of the app store when the app isn't installed, and the routing cache TTL dropped to 10 minutes. Fewer "stuck on store page" tickets expected. The new default routing config follows.

config for kagup-hahig:
druwyn:
  pin: 2801
  metrics_host: metrics.druwyn.zemvarlabs.internal
  tenant: sorius
  seal: seal_798a43d7